62 Utility and 17 Design Patents
#1 in Tuttlingen
#1,005 in Germany
#25,170 in the World
rank by utility patentsForward Citations = 8,651
Company Filing History:
Get your Inventor Badge Today
#1 in Tuttlingen
#1,005 in Germany
#25,170 in the World
rank by utility patentsCompany Filing History:
Get your Inventor Badge Today